ANOTHER SUICIDE.

(by telegraph. ) Dunedin, November 6. Mrs. Agnes Weir, the wife of Mr. John Weir, of Williamsborough, Mornington, took poison yesterday afternoon. Her husband, who has been earning very little for some time past, contemplated going up the country, and for this purpose had purchased a pack-horse and saddle. Mrs. Weir was adverse to his leaving, and this, in conjunction with family matters, led her to commit the rash act. She was taken to the hospital, where she died this afternoon.
